  • Ronald Harwood, Oscar-winning ‘The Pianist’ screenwriter, dies at 85

    Ronald Harwood, Oscar-winning ‘The Pianist’ screenwriter, dies at 85

    Ronald Harwood, a South African screenwriter most known for “The Pianist “has died. The Oscar-winning writer was 85. Harwood, who also wrote “The Dresser” and “The Diving Bell and the Butterfly,” died Tuesday of natural causes in his Sussex home. The writer was born in South Africa in 1934.
